Tasmania in May 2014: late-season warmth
May was another relatively warm month for Tasmania, with near-average rainfall in most parts, though slightly drier about the northeast.
After a cool start to the month, a high pressure system settled over the Tasman Sea and directed a warm northwesterly flow over Tasmania. This produced a string of warmer than average days during the middle of the month with the 15th being particularly warm about the southeast. Several sites experienced record late-season maximum temperatures, including Hobart with 23.9 °C. Campania reached a maximum temperature of 24.1 °C, which is the highest maximum temperature so late in the season for any Tasmanian site, and broke the previous record of 23.8 °C set at Hobart in 1904. This prolonged warm spell also affected much of Australia (as detailed in Special Climate Statement 49). Although temperatures returned closer to average towards the end of the month, May was a warm month overall.

A Monthly Climate Summary is prepared to list the main features of the weather in Tasmania using the most timely and accurate information available on the date of publication; it will generally not be updated. Later information, including data that has had greater opportunity for quality control, will be presented in the Monthly Weather Review, usually published in the fourth week of the month.
A Climate Summary is generally published on the first working day of each month.
This statement has been prepared based on information available at 8 am on Monday 2 June 2014. Some checks have been made on the data, but it is possible that results will change as new information becomes available.
Averages are long-term means based on observations from all
available years of record, which vary widely from site to site. They are
not shown for sites with less than 10 years of record, as they cannot
then be calculated reliably.
The median
is sometimes more representative than the mean
of long-term average rain.
The Rank indicates how rainfall this time compares with the
climate record for the site, based on the decile
ranking (very low rainfall is in decile 1, low in
decile 2 or 3, average in decile 4 to 7, high in decile
8 or 9 and very high is in decile 10).
The Fraction of average shows how much rain has fallen this time
as a percentage
of the long-term mean.
